The original Fender Princeton was a low-powered amplifier, created as a portable solution to getting great valve tone. The amp found popularity in the studio due to its ability to create driven valve tones at a sensible volume level, and it became the secret weapon of countless players including Mac DeMarco, Pete Townsend, Gary Clark Jr., and even Jimi Hendrix!
The FSR '65 Princeton Reverb features 12 watts of valve power, making it the perfect unit to switch seamlessly from the practice room to the studio and onto the stage for small gigs and jam sessions. It has a single channel design for a vintage-style response to your playing dynamics along with built-in reverb and vibrato for the complete one-box tone package.
The '65 Princeton Reverb is loaded with Groove Tubes 6V6 power amp valves. These valves create a big and dynamic sound that provides room for the natural dynamics of your playing to shine through. The 6V6 tubes are fed with 12AX7 preamp tubes which create a range of tones from clean to overdrive, via the single-channel preamp controls with EQ. Single-channel amps are designed to be dialled in to a static sound, on top of which you control your gain level with guitar volume control adjustments and effects pedals. The '65 Princeton Reverb responds very well to booster and overdrive pedals, where the additional input can push the tubes into increased saturation and compression for smooth solo sounds. The amp also responds to your playing dynamics and guitar volume control adjustments, making for a highly interactive playing experience.
A tube-driven spring reverb effect drenches your tone in a lush ambience, helping to 'pad out' your sound and giving a range of reverb effects from a subtle tone widening to all-out ambient saturation. The '65 Princeton Reverb also has a tube-driven vibrato circuit which creates a tremolo sound for a classic vintage feel. A two-button footswitch provides on/off control for each effect which is perfect for live performance control.
The Eminence Cannabis Rex speaker is a 12'' driver with a clean and full sound. It provides plenty of body and sparkle with a smooth high-end definition. This makes it the perfect speaker for country, jazz, blues, vintage rock, and other low/medium-gain styles of music. The speaker is mounted in a birch/pine cabinet with an open back for a room-filling resonance and projection.
The FSR Princeton Reverb is covered in a lacquered tweed finish and features a Bassman-style grill cloth. The control panel is coloured like the Fender pre-CBS "Black Panel" design and gives this amp an instant vintage-look that will make a strong impression on stage or in your studio.
